QUOTE(xphr3ak @ Feb 26 2020, 01:25 PM) » Click to show Spoiler - click again to hide... « Hello Guys, Is this diagram correct? For kitchen sink and washing machine will be use direct water from main source. Bathroom will use water from tank. I am not sure either use ball valve/butterfly valve/stockoff. Can use water from tank for kitchen sink and washing machine? Is it safe? If i am not mistaken, i have read from this thread/somewhere for kitchen sink/washing machine is advisable to use water direct from main. UPDATE: My contractor said building by-law not allow to use water from tank. Thanks. [attachmentid=10435589] You need a check valve (one way valve) at your bypass line after ball valve 1. This is to prevent your pump from pumping backwards i.e (pumping after ball valve 3 into the bypass line) and creating a pumping loop. Hope it makes sense.
